Application for Redevelopment Waiver

Greenspring Overlook Apartments
2400-2418 & 2401-2407 Loyola Northway
Baltimore City, Maryland

The City of Baltimore Department of Public Works is accepting public review and comments on this project’s application for a redevelopment waiver. If granted, the project will still need to provide water qualitative controls, per the requirements of the State’s Design Manual. 

Applicant: Royal Oaks Associates, LLP c/o AHC, Inc.  2230 N. Fairfax Drive, Suite 100, Arlington, VA 22201
ESD #: 7810
Watershed(s): Jones Falls

Project Description: The project has an approximate area of 0.5 acres and is located Southwest of the intersection of Greenspring Avenue and W. Cold Spring Lane. The project will consist of modification of the existing sidewalks, ramps and parking to meet current ADA requirements.

The Applicant is requesting a redevelopment waiver in accordance with Article 7, §23-7 of the City Code.  The existing impervious area coverage meets the conditions for this waiver.  The project will provide qualitative control to satisfy the requirements of this waiver for 26,700 sq. ft (0.61 ac) of this project. 

AND

The Applicant will satisfy the part of the redevelopment reduced control requirement water quality controls by returning to pre-existing conditions for 19,100 sq. ft (0.43 ac) of this project.
